WWVB Disciplined Oscillator

Informacja

The Spectracom MODEL 8164 WWVB Receiver DISCIPLINED OSCILLATOR* is a frequency standard with accuracy directly traceable to the National Bureau of Standards. The Spectracom MODEL 8206 ferrite loop Antenna is used to receive to 60 kHz carrier of WWVB. The Model 8164 is continuously monitored against WWVB and kept on frequency by a microprocessor. The Oscillator outputs can be used as a precise external input for transmitters, receivers, counters, synthesizers, and other electronic equipment. Figure 1-1 shows the Model 8164 Disciplined Oscillator and the Model 8206 Antenna. 1.1 FEATURES The Model 8164 WWVB Receiver-Disciplined Oscillator offers the following features: BUILT-IN PHASE COMPARATOR - may be used to compare the phase of the internal ovenized Oscillator or local input with the received WWVB signal. Results are recorded on the strip chart recorder. TRACEABILITY - verification to the National Bureau of Standards is done by noting the hourly WWVB phase shift identification. The hourly offsets appear as "tick” marks on the strip chart recording. ALARM STATUS - operational status is communicated by alarm lamps and RS-422 alarm outputs. SELECTABLE FRONT PANEL OUTPUTS - 0.1, 1.0, 5.0 or 10 MHz TTL compatible signals of the phase locked and standard Oscillator outputs. FREQUENCY OFFSETS - with the addition of a frequency offset option, the internal 10 MHz standard Oscillator is offset a precise amount. The offset frequency used as a reference to a television or paging Transmitter reduces or eliminates co-channel interference. DISTRIBUTION OUTPUTS - with the addition of Option 03, Built-In Distribution Amplifier, up to 25 remote stations may use the standard outputs as a common time base.
